Finasteride | an oral medication prescribed for men only to stimulate hair growth
🗑
|
||||
Flap Surgery | a surgical technique that involves the removal of a bald scalp area and the attachment of a flap of hair-bearing skin.
🗑
|
||||
Full Head Bonding | the process of attaching a hair replacement system to all areas of the head with an adhesive bonding agent.
🗑
|
||||
Hackling | process used to comb through the hair strands to separate them
🗑
|
||||
Hair Replacement System | formerly called a hairpiece; also known as hair solution.
🗑
|
||||
Hair Solution | any small wig used to cover the top or crown of the head and integrated with the natural hair.
🗑
|
||||
Hair Transplantation | any form of hair restoration that involves the surgical removal and relocation of hair; including scalp reduction and flap surgery
🗑
|
||||
Lace-Front | popular hair solution style used for off-the-face styles
🗑
|
||||
Minoxidil | topical medication used to promote hair growth or reduce hair loss
🗑
|
||||
Root-Turning | refers to sorting the hair strands so that the cuticle points toward the hair ends in its natural direction of growth
🗑
|
||||
Scalp Reduction | the surgical removal of a bald area, followed by the pulling together of the scalp ends.
🗑
|
||||
Styling or Wig Block | head-shaped form made of plastic, foam or other materials used as a stand for a wig ot hair replacement system.
🗑
|
||||
Toupee | outdated term used to describe a small hair replacement that covers the top or crown of the head.
